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The organization is a non-partisan research institute and think tank. It is dedicated to advancing the public interest through manufacturing technology and policy. It supports government agencies, by conducting applied research and innovations to address the nation's critical defense-related production challenges. This is achieved through federally sponsored contracting, cooperative research, and partnerships.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

A draft copy of the form 990 and attachments is provided to the board of directors for review prior to filing of the return.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Directors, principal officers, or members of a committee ("interested persons") must disclose the existence of financial interests that could give rise to conflicts and provide all material facts to the board. The board will then decide if a conflict of interest exists or appoint a 3rd party to investigate. After exercising due diligence, the board will determine whether the organization can obtain with reasonable efforts a more advantageous transaction or arrangement from a person or entity that would not give rise to a conflict of interest. If a more advantageous transaction or arrangement is not reasonably possible under circumstances not producing a conflict of interest, the board will then decide as to whether to enter into the transaction or arrangement. The policy is distributed to interested persons on an annual basis. The board will take appropirate disciplinary and corrective action if it determines that an interested peson fails to disclose an actual or possible conflict of interest

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The board has looked at compensation of other nonprofit organizations with similar missions to determine suitable compensation for top management in future years.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The organization makes its governing documents, conflict of interest policy and financial statements available to the public upon request.
